The Madurai bench of the Madras high court has lifted the ban on TikTok. The court directed ByteDance to regularly monitor and regulate content on the app. It also said that failure to do so will attract contempt proceedings.

Senior counsel representing TikTok said that the company had been affected and was facing losses since the ban. He said that following the order of the court, ByteDance acted swiftly and removed obscene content and would continue its regulatory mechanism.
